The contact moment explained: Why does the Netherlands interrupt your game?

The contact moment is a fundamental part of the Dutch regulations for online gambling. According to the Remote Gambling Act, licensees must interrupt players at regular intervals with a notification or check-in. This mandatory playtime break aims to create awareness: the player gains insight into the elapsed time, the total amount wagered, and any limits. The Gaming Authority strictly enforces these rules to detect problematic gambling behavior at an early stage.

For the player, this often feels like patronizing. You are taken out of your flow by a pop-up asking if you want to continue or stop. This mechanism is closely linked to the self-exclusion system (Cruks), which completely excludes high-risk players from legal Dutch platforms. The contact moment therefore acts as a soft brake, while Cruks is the hard stop. Without these interruptions, you decide when to pause, resulting in a smoother experience but less external control.

Is a casino without mandatory breaks legal in the Netherlands?

A casino without mandatory breaks typically operates under a foreign license and falls outside the Dutch supervision of the Gaming Authority. For the player, participating in illegal online gambling at these providers is not a punishable offense, but the provider does act in violation of the Remote Gambling Act. As a result, players miss out on the protection of the Cruks register and are personally responsible for their gaming behavior and tax liabilities.

The position of the Gaming Authority and enforcement

The Gaming Authority, the national regulator for the gambling market, maintains a strict Gaming Authority Enforcement Policy aimed at keeping illegal providers off the Dutch market. The Ministry of Justice and Security has structured the legislation such that the focus is on combatting the offering, not on criminalizing the consumer. This means that for individual players, there is no direct threat of a fine (Boetebedreiging) when they choose a platform without a Dutch license.

Still, the situation remains complex. Providers that actively target Dutch players without a license are guilty of illegal online gambling from a legal perspective. The Gaming Authority attempts to block these sites through ISP filtering and by targeting payment providers. For the player, this means that while playing is not prohibited, you fall outside the safe framework of Dutch law. The Gaming Authority Enforcement Policy ensures that legal providers are strictly monitored, while foreign sites operate in a gray area where consumer protection is minimal.

Risks for players: fines and protection

The biggest risk at a casino without mandatory breaks is the lack of connection with Cruks (Central Register for Exclusion of Games of Chance). At legal Dutch casinos, every player is automatically checked against this register. If you play with a foreign provider, you fall outside this system and miss the automatic self-exclusion in the event of signs of problematic behavior.

As a player, you are completely responsible for monitoring your own limits. There are no mandatory pop-ups or intervals that force you to reflect. In addition, illegal online gambling can lead to financial complications. Winnings at foreign casinos are not always tax-free; depending on the provider's license, you may have to pay gambling tax to the Tax Administration (Belastingdienst) yourself, unlike legal providers who do this automatically. Furthermore, the Gaming Authority does not offer a dispute committee for conflicts with unlicensed parties, making the recovery of money from unreliable operators virtually impossible.

Licenses and safety: Curacao vs MGA

A casino without mandatory breaks typically operates under a foreign license, such as a Curacao license or MGA license, which means the platform is not connected to the Dutch CRUKS register. While these licenses guarantee a basic level of fair play through SSL encryption and independent audits, they do not offer protection against addiction as prescribed by the Gaming Authority. Players must be aware that they fall outside Dutch supervision, meaning that limits and complaint procedures are handled differently.

Why do providers choose a Curacao license?

Many international operators choose a license from Curacao eGaming because of the more flexible regulations and lower operational costs compared to European jurisdictions. A casino with a Curacao license is often faster to set up and offers more flexibility in bonuses and payment methods, such as cryptocurrency. But are these platforms safe? Yes, provided you choose providers that transparently display their license number and utilize modern security technologies such as SSL encryption.

However, reliability depends heavily on the specific operator. While the Gaming Authority in the Netherlands imposes strict requirements on solvency and player protection, supervision under Curacao eGaming varies per sub-license holder. In our tests, we see that reputable Curacao casinos do indeed work with recognized testing agencies such as eCOGRA to verify the fairness of games. Yet, the direct link with the CRUKS register is missing, meaning there is no automatic block for high-risk players. This makes extra self-discipline necessary, since the 'self-exclusion' functionality does not automatically activate here in case of suspicious behavior.

The difference with the Malta Gaming Authority (MGA)

The key distinction between an MGA license and a Curacao license lies in the strictness of supervision and consumer protection. The Malta Gaming Authority is known as one of the most respected regulators in Europe and applies rules that are close to those of Dutch legislation, including strict KYC (Know Your Customer) procedures. Casinos with an MGA license often offer a higher level of certainty regarding payouts and dispute resolution than their Curacao counterparts.

With an MGA license, you are less likely to encounter issues with large wins because the regulator actively takes action against fraudulent practices. In contrast, casinos under Curacao eGaming are known for their higher betting limits and less restrictive bonus terms, but also for offering less direct legal recourse for the player. For players looking for a casino without mandatory breaks but who value European standards, the MGA is often a safer middle ground than Curacao, although here too there is no link with the Dutch Cruks system.

The relationship between the license and the CRUKS register

The absence of a link to the CRUKS register is the technical reason why a casino without mandatory breaks is possible at all. The Central Register for Exclusion of Games of Chance (Cruks) is managed by the Gaming Authority and is only binding for holders of a Dutch license. Foreign licensees, whether they are from Malta or Curacao, do not have access to this register and are not legally required to check players for exclusion.

This means that a registration in Cruks has no effect on your gaming behavior at these international providers. Although this feels like a liberation from the 'patronization' for some players, the safety net of the self-exclusion system also disappears. Without the intervention of the Gaming Authority, you are completely dependent on the integrity of the foreign licensor, such as Curacao eGaming or the Malta Gaming Authority. It is crucial to realize that playing at these providers means you waive the Dutch protective measures, including the mandatory breaks and deposit limits imposed by law.

Does iDEAL still work at foreign casinos?

Can I use iDEAL without Cruks? Using iDEAL at foreign casinos is complex and often limited. iDEAL is a Dutch payment system that works closely with the Dutch Payments Association (Betaalvereniging Nederland). This association plays an active role in maintaining the integrity of payment traffic by blocking or flagging transactions to unlicensed providers. Because iDEAL is directly linked to your bank account, it acts as a bridge to the CRUKS register, which many foreign operators want to avoid.

Although some international sites still accept iDEAL through intermediaries, its availability is decreasing due to pressure from the Dutch Payments Association on financial institutions to stop cooperating with illegal gambling providers. Players who still wish to use iDEAL run the risk of their account being frozen or deposits being rejected as soon as the link to a non-Dutch license is detected. For anonymity and continuity, experienced players therefore more often choose alternatives that do not fall under these national restrictions.

Help organizations: AGOG and Loket Kansspel

Where can I find help for problematic gambling behavior? If self-regulation fails, specialized organizations are crucial. AGOG (Anonieme Gokkers Om Gokkers) offers peer support through group discussions, where experiences are shared in a safe environment. This organization focuses specifically on recovery from gambling addiction through peer contact, which many players experience as more effective than individual therapy in the early stages.

Additionally, Loket Kansspel is the central contact point for questions and complaints about games of chance. Although this organization is primarily focused on consumer protection within the Dutch framework, it also provides information on support options. For players at foreign providers, it is important to realize that Loket Kansspel has no legal authority over these platforms, but can refer to international helplines or general advice lines such as OpenOverGokken. The relationship between self-exclusion and this assistance is direct: a self-exclusion via Cruks is a preventive measure, while AGOG and Loket Kansspel perform curative and supportive roles for already existing problems.
